Transaction 7496b95326c2be61bd24569948144887cbc132ddd426d453d6c8f751bf08e4f9
1 Input
1 Output
-
7496b95326c2be61bd24569948144887cbc132ddd426d453d6c8f751bf08e4f9:0
- value
- 6447585
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a8869638b2fb2d91877a88a443ba82dce890e17f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GN5kUz87yQJhJoP9nYwcCs47oMgoAFc72